Description:

This is the second printing of Elizabeth Melton Parsons phenomenal book of poetry, Out of Darkness. Dedicated to all who have ever experienced abuse/violence in their lives. You'll find these subjects and many others within these pages. Love, loss, desire, fantasy, it's all here. These poems will inspire and entertain.
